#646621 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#646621 is composed of 39.2% red, 40% green and 12.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 2% cyan, 0% magenta, 67.6% yellow and 60% black. It has a hue angle of 61.7 degrees, a saturation of 51.1% and a lightness of 26.5%. #646621 color hex could be obtained by blending #c8cc42 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666633.

Shades and Tints of #646621

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d0d04 is the darkest color, while #fefefd is the lightest one.
